Planning is the key

Planning is the key to having the best picnic and camping experience. Picnicking and camping are two of the best summer activities. They’re perfect for spending time with family and friends, getting some fresh air, and enjoying the great outdoors. Here are some tips to help you plan:

  • Pick a good location: A beautiful spot will make your picnic or camping trip that much more enjoyable. Make sure to pick a place that is safe and easy to get to.
  • Choose the right food: Picnic and camping food should be easy to transport and store. Finger foods are always a good option, as they can be easily eaten on the go. Don’t forget to pack plenty of snacks and drinks!
  • Plan activities: What will you do while you’re picnicking or camping? Make sure to bring along some games or other activities to keep everyone entertained.

With a little bit of planning, you’re sure to have the best picnic or camping trip ever! Just remember to relax and have fun. After all, that’s what picnics and camping are all about.

In choosing and bringing drinks, it is essential to think about what will happen if you get thirsty. A good rule of thumb is to bring one gallon per person, per day. And it’s also important to have a variety of beverages, including some non-alcoholic options like iced tea or lemonade. As for alcohol, beer is always a popular choice among campers, but be sure to bring a designated driver if you’re planning on indulging!

Keep your cooler cold by using ice or frozen water bottles.

The technique is to pack heavier items on the bottom of the cooler and lighter items on top. This will keep your ice from melting too quickly. Bring an extra cooler filled with ice beside the cooler with the beverages and ice. Frozen water bottles can double as both ice and drinking water. If you don’t have a lot of space, use smaller containers that can be refrozen instead of one large container.

Another tip is to use mayo jars or other glass jars to keep your food cold. Glass retains the cold better than plastic containers. Place the jars in the cooler with a frozen water bottle and the food will stay cold.

Pack sandwiches in a zip loc bag to keep them from getting crushed. If you are bringing a basket, pack the heavier items at the bottom and softer items on top.

Wrap baked goods in wax paper or place them in a container with a lid. This will help prevent them from becoming dry or stale.

Pack a first-aid kit in case of emergencies.

Pack insect repellent to keep the bugs away. Always be careful and ready. Do not forget the first-aid kit because you never know what might happen. The first-aid kit must contain bandages, antiseptic wipes, antibiotic ointment, pain reliever medicine, and anything else you might need. Also, remember to pack sunscreen and hats to protect you from the sun. Be sure to have a fun time! And most importantly be safe! Follow these tips for the best picnic and camping experience ever.

Plan fun activities to do while you're camping or picnicking.

Here are some ideas to get you started:

  • Take a hike and explore your surroundings. Pack a lunch and make a day of it!
  • Play some games! Bring along a frisbee or football, or set up an impromptu game of tag.
  • If you’re picnicking near a body of water, go for a swim! Just be sure to take all the necessary safety precautions.
  • Sit back, relax, and take in the scenery. Don’t forget to bring along a good book or your journal.
  • Get up close and personal with nature. Go on a scavenger hunt or try your hand at birdwatching.
  • do a bonfire! Gather around with some friends and roast marshmallows, tell stories and sing songs. the fire will also make you feel warm and cozy every night.
  • Take a scenic drive or go for a bike ride. There’s no shortage of beautiful scenery to take in while you’re camping or picnicking. So get out there and enjoy it!
